Job summary

Project Hospitality Inc. is seeking a Client Care Coordinator for Callaghan House in Staten Island, NY. The role focuses on warm, compassionate client interactions and maintaining safety in a 24-hour residence.

You will assist with daily living, medication monitoring, and transportation to activities, while supporting diverse clients and a team in crisis-responsive settings.

Qualifications

  • High School Diploma/GED with relevant experience; Bachelor’s degree preferred.
  • Certificate of Fitness for Coordinator of Fire Safety and Alarm Systems in Homeless Shelters (F-80) within 3 months.
  • Valid clean Driver's License required.
  • Experience with homeless, MICA and/or substance abuse populations.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ure client safety and provide direct care in a 24-hour residence.
  • Monitor self-administration of medications per policy.
  • Assist with activities of daily living (ADL) and meals.
  • Oversee client activities, run socialization groups, maintain safety.
  • Provide client transportation to program activities as needed.
